For tractor implements... definitely would prioritize a quality PTO wood chipper given your location and circumstances. The ability to create animal bedding, as well as a supplement to your growing pastures (woodchips) and for gardening would be a huge benefit, and you have so much forest surrounding and on your property there is always a mess of blowdown and other tree materials from clearing, it would really make a lot of sense to invest sooner rather than later, especially now that you increased the PTO HP by 50% compared to your older tractor.

Al don't put in a blue bulb. Put in a red or green. Red is best as it affects your night vision the least. Blue effects your night vision the most. Military use green for night vision goggles because contour lines on maps are red. So we prefer to see on a map if there is a 200 ft cliff or flat ground. But red is the best to help retain your natural night vision.
